    Welcome to the Apple Discussions.
    Try the following:
    1 - delete the iWeb preference file, com.apple.iWeb.plist, that resides in your User/Library/Preferences folder.
    2 - go to your User/Library/Caches/com.apple.iWeb folder and delete the contents.
    3 - reboot.
    4 - launch iWeb and see if you can publish.
    If that doesn't help continue:
    5 - move the domain file from your User/Library/Application Support/iWeb folder to the Desktop.
    6 - launch iWeb, create a new test site and save.
    7 - go to the your User/Library/Application Support/iWeb folder and delete the new domain file.
    8 - move your original domain file from the Desktop to the iWeb folder.
    9 - launch iWeb and try again.

  • I have created a site but can't open it in iweb after it has been done.

    I created a site using iweb, and then tried one of the free templates that a website was offering. After I open the template I was no longer able to open the site I created. I can locate the files in the Sites folder, but it will not allow me to open it.
    Does anyone know what I can do so I don't have o recreate it all over? This would be a total nightmare!
    Thanks,
    RandyfromLacey

    If the files are in your sites folder, then iWeb will never be able to open them because they contain your published site.  iWeb has no import facility so is unable to open html pages - a previously published site.
    You need the data storage file called domain.sites to be able to access your site again.  This can be found under User/Library/Application Support/iWeb/domain.sites.  Find this file and double click it and iWeb will open it.
    Note that you need to look in your User Library and not your System Library, as you won't find iWeb there.

  • How do I create two iWeb sites using a single .Mac account?

    I would like to create two distinct sites/URLs using iWeb and a single — not a family — .Mac account. Is this possible? If so, what are the basic steps?
    When I read related forum posts, it would seem to me that one site would overwrite the other site when I publish. Yes or no?

    If you just do the obvious and use File > New Site in iWeb, you do create two distinct sites with different urls. However, you cannot exactly duplicate page names in the sites or publish changes in one without publishing changes in the other. The short default url web.mac.com/username/iWeb normally goes to the top site on the list within iWeb.
    If you create two sites with distinct names in different accounts on your machine, they should not overwrite each other, and they should also have distinct urls. However I think that the
    index.html file which tells browsers what to do with the default short url web.mac.com/username/iWeb may get confused, so that deleting that or modifying it manually might be desirable.

  • How do I remove old web site when publishing new site with same URL in iweb? Hit replace when publishing new iweb site (so we could have control over changes) but new site name is attached to old via a / after our www address we want to keep.

    I hit the replace when publishing the new iweb site (so we could have control over changes - last one was not an apple based site) but new site name is attached to old via a forward slash and underscore after our www address. Makes it very messy with a very long web address.  Original address now followed by iweb site name followed by name of first page? Went for iweb as not that computer literate - all going so well?! Cheers for help in anticipation. Have to get off to work now but be great end to week if we could be sorted tonight. Rupes

    Well yes of course, if you try and publish through iWeb there won't be an option to publish without your site folder which is exactly why I told you to download Cyberduck and use Cyberduck to upload your site to your server having published your site from iWeb to a local folder.  That is what you need to do if you don't want your site name to be included in yoru url.
    It would have been easier also if you had used Cyberduck initially to connect to your server and delete your old site yourself - at least that way you would have deleted the correct files rather than relying on your hosting service to do it and doing it incorrectly.
    Download Cyberduck and then select the publish to a local folder option from iWeb and then use Cyberduck to upload your site to your server, but rather than uploading the whole site folder and separate index file, upload ONLY the contents of your site folder and then your url will be http://www.domain.com/page_name.html.
